Top 5 Tips for Successfully Repairing Your Natuzzi Leather Couch

Leather couches, especially those from Natuzzi, are known for their elegance and durability. However, over time, they can experience wear and tear that necessitates repairs. Whether it’s a scratch, tear, or fading color, repairing your Natuzzi leather couch doesn’t have to be daunting. Here are the top five tips to help you successfully restore your beloved piece of furniture.

Assess the Damage Thoroughly

Before diving into any repairs, take a moment to assess the extent of the damage on your Natuzzi leather couch. Look for scratches, scuffs, tears, or discoloration. Understanding the specific issues will help you determine which repair methods and products will be most effective for your situation.

Gather Necessary Materials

Once you know what you’re dealing with, gather all necessary materials before starting the repair process. Common supplies include leather cleaner, conditioner, patch kits for larger tears or cuts, dye or color matching products for color restoration, and microfiber cloths for application.

Clean Your Couch Properly

Cleaning is an essential step in preparing your Natuzzi leather couch for repair. Use a high-quality leather cleaner to gently remove dirt and oils that may interfere with adhesive or dye applications. Always test any cleaner on a small inconspicuous area first to ensure it doesn’t cause further damage.

Use Appropriate Repair Techniques

For minor scratches and scuffs on the surface of your leather couch, a simple application of leather conditioner may suffice. For deeper scratches or tears that require more attention, consider using a specialized leather repair kit that includes adhesive patches designed specifically for leather surfaces.

Maintain Regular Care After Repairs

After successfully repairing your Natuzzi leather couch, it’s important to establish a regular maintenance routine to preserve its condition. This includes periodic cleaning with appropriate products and conditioning every 6-12 months to keep the leather supple and prevent future damage.
